N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

A family member reported that the pilot purchased the airplane about one month before the accident. The pilot had been conducting taxi tests until the day of the accident, which was his first flight in the airplane. Witnesses observed the airplane use most of the runway to takeoff. After liftoff, the airplane was at a high angle-of-attack and not climbing very fast. The pilot-rated passenger reported that the airplane attained an altitude of approximately 700 feet above ground level when the airplane stalled. The airplane then descended in a nose-low attitude to ground impact. Postaccident examination of the wreckage revealed no evidence of a pre-impact mechanical malfunction or failure.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The pilot’s failure to maintain adequate airspeed which resulted in a stall and loss of control during the initial climb.
